    Is this combination allowed?
    NO
    Can't have S2 in Maths without S1, can't have M2 in Maths without M1
    You need 6 units for FM and you only list 5
    You don't have to do FP1 FP2 and FP3 though you can if you wish - you must do FP1 and either FP2 or FP3 and can instead do another applications unit, fyi most people seem to prefer FP3 to FP2

    (Original post by Casshern1456)
    Is it possible to do FP3 without FP2, M3 without M2? I'd hate to be half way through FP3 and finding areas I don't completely grasp and having to look through FP2 books (even if I don't take it) I want to have an overall understanding of the modules I take, FP1 and FP3 w/o FP2 just seems like gaps in my knowledge or is this false? :confused: Not that I deliberately want to take easier-routes to FM because I want to complete it in 1 year.
    You can't do M3 without taking M2. you need complete knowledge of M1-2, C1-4 for M3.

    You can do FP3 without FP2. Both require knowledge of FP1 and C1-4. There are no topics in FP3 that require FP2 knowledge, though i will recommend doing both as these two are quite a lot more interesting modules compared to others.
